Cassidy E. Chivers and Kendra L. Basner, San Francisco based partners at Hinshaw & Culbertson LLP, authored the article "Make Your Firm's Practice Groups a Risk Management Tool," published by The Recorder on April 6, 2016.
The article analyzes why the practice group concept, which traditionally has been used as a marketing and internal training tool, should also be the law firm's core vehicle for risk management. The article explains that collaboration on client work is important because of an improved ability to catch errors, promote efficiency and morale, and provide the best practices and value for the client.
